Shenzhen, China – In a significant leap for AI-driven animation, Tencent Hunyuan, in collaboration with Tsinghua University, Sun Yat-sen University, and the Hong Kong University of Science and Technology, has launched HunyuanPortrait, a novel framework for generating highly controllable and realistic portrait animations. This cutting-edge technology, powered by diffusion models, promises to revolutionize fields ranging from virtual reality to gaming and human-computer interaction.

What is HunyuanPortrait?

HunyuanPortrait leverages a single portrait image as a visual reference and a video clip as a driving template. By analyzing the facial expressions and head movements within the driving video, the framework animates the reference portrait, effectively transferring the nuances of the video onto the still image.

HunyuanPortrait represents a significant advancement in the field of AI-driven animation, said a representative from Tencent Hunyuan. Its ability to decouple appearance and motion across diverse image styles, while maintaining temporal consistency and control, sets it apart from existing methods.

Key Features and Capabilities:

  • Highly Controllable Portrait Animation Generation: HunyuanPortrait precisely maps facial expressions and head poses from a driving video onto a reference portrait, resulting in fluid and natural animation.
  • Robust Identity Preservation: Even with significant differences in facial structure and motion intensity, the framework maintains the identity of the reference portrait, preventing distortion and ensuring accurate representation.
  • Realistic Facial Dynamic Capture: HunyuanPortrait captures subtle facial expressions, including eye gaze and lip synchronization, generating highly realistic portrait animations.
  • Optimized Temporal Consistency: The generated videos exhibit smooth transitions and consistent movement, eliminating jarring artifacts and enhancing the overall viewing experience.
